About the Roles
Building Surveyor
As the Building Surveyor, you will ensure a safe and compliant urban built environment by assessing building applications and enforcing regulations. You will work closely with stakeholders to provide expert technical advice and support.
You'll be responsible for:
- Assessment of certified and uncertified building permits and applications (including occupancy permits and building approval certificates)
- Interpreting the building legislation and providing technical advice to internal and external stakeholders
- Assisting in the training and mentoring of Assistant Building Surveyors
- Providing customer service to external stakeholders on a range of building matters.
Assistant Building Surveyor
As the Assistant Building Surveyor you will have the unique opportunity to gain hands-on experience in building surveying. You'll be an integral part of our team, ensuring compliance with the Building Act, Building Code of Australia, Council Policies and all other relevant regulations.
You'll be responsible for:
- Assisting with the interpretation of building legislation
- Reviewing and assisting applicants complete building applications
- Providing administrative and customer service support to the building services team
To be successful in this role, you will possess:
Building Surveyor
- Qualification in Building Surveying or equivalent experience (Level 3 technician or higher)
- Current 'C' Class Drivers Licence
- A Construction Induction Card (White card) or commitment to obtain this upon being offered the role
- Experience in interpreting maps and building plans, investigating, researching and reporting of building matters.
Assistant Building Surveyor
- Certificate III in Business Administration or similar, or equivalent relevant experience
- Commitment to enrol in a Diploma in Building Surveying or a Bachelor of Building Surveying upon being offered the role
- Commitment to obtain a Construction Induction Card (White card) upon being offered the role
